Lennon_on_Jesus_comment_66.wav - An attempt to explain to his audience the meaning of this statement that the Beatles were more popular than Jesus. Though it was clothed as an apology in an effort to comfort those who needed to hear one, it was in fact an attempt to rationally explain and justify the validity of the statement -- that popular music, and the Beatles in particular, meant more to contemporary youth than religion -- and nothing more.
